– The constitutional crisis in Poland is deepening, and there is no will on the part of the executive or legislative branches to end these unlawful actions – stated Bogdan Święczkowski during a media briefing.
"On January 31st, I signed a 60-page notification of a crime concerning the justified suspicion of criminal offenses committed by the Prime Minister, ministers, the Marshal of the Sejm, the Marshal of the Senate, members of parliament and senators of the ruling coalition, the head of the Government Legislation Center, certain judges and prosecutors, and other individuals. This crime consists of the fact that from December 13, 2023, to the present day, in Warsaw and other locations in Poland, these individuals, acting as part of an organized criminal group, in short intervals, with a premeditated intent, aiming to change the constitutional order of the Republic of Poland, and acting to achieve or cease the activity of the Constitutional Tribunal and other constitutional bodies, including the National Council of the Judiciary and the Supreme Court, have, in agreement with other persons, undertaken activities aimed at realizing these goals through violence and unlawful threat, by eliminating the possibility of operation for the Constitutional Tribunal and other constitutional bodies, including the National Council of the Judiciary and the Supreme Court."
– We are talking here about the crime of a coup d'état – emphasized the President of the Constitutional Tribunal.
– I have requested that an investigation be initiated by the legally appointed Deputy Prosecutor General, Michał Ostrowski, as part of the mandatory referral, and for him to personally conduct this proceeding as his own investigation. Yesterday, February 4th, I was questioned by a prosecutor as the complainant. Today, I was informed by the Deputy Prosecutor General that he has initiated an investigation in this matter – he added.
